Dues

Dues for Associate Members is a flat fee of $150 for twelve months.  Dues are 
payable by check or money order, and must accompany the membership 
application. This dues payment is not deductible as a charitable contribution.  
However, for most members this fee is deductible as a business expense.  
Twenty percent of member dues will be used for lobbying expenses on behalf of 
the members.  Membership is for a one-year period.  Membership is not 
transferrable or refundable.


Participation in Association Professional Groups and Programs

AOP will operate and support professional groups and committees that work 
cooperatively to the betterment of the industry.  Members are invited and 
encouraged to participate in these programs.  They include, but are not 
limited to:

-- A Public Policy Group to coordinate legislative and regulatory responses 
   at the International, Federal and State levels in support of member 
   interests.
-- A SysOp Certification Committee that will design a training course and 
   test to become an AOP Certified System Operator.  This designation is a 
   hallmark of professional achievement, and oversight of this process is one 
   of the most important contributions a member can make.
-- An Industry Marketing Group to develop and implement joint marketing 
   programs to members and consumers.
-- An Associate Section Board of Governors that will direct the activities of 
   the Associate membership section, setting priorities and guiding the 
   section staff in providing services to associate members.  Board members 
   are elected for a one-year term.
-- An Industry Awards Committee that will establish categories, define 
   criteria, select judges and make awards for achievements in online 
   communication.
-- The Standards Committee will establish a Code of Professional Standards 
   for member system operators.  In cases where violation of this code is 
   alleged, members of this committee will serve to evaluate cases and 
   recommend appropriate actions.
